The Space Race culminated in 1969 when humanity walked on the Moon, achieving a dream older than civilization and marking a landmark in exploration.
Despite numerous early milestones, the Soviets, led by Sergei Korolev's innovative vision, ultimately could not achieve the Moon landing, which became an American triumph.
The factors crucial for human spaceflight differ significantly from aeronautics, including fuel sources and materials that protect against extreme conditions in space.
The legacy of the Space Race serves as a beacon for future human exploration, emphasizing the importance of innovation, perseverance, and global cooperation.
